In Latest Poll McCain Holds Small Edge in Florida

The latest Miami Herald poll puts Senator John McCain slightly ahead of Senator Barack Obama.

McCain 47%

Obama 45%

Obama Now Way Out in Front in Iowa

The latest Research 2000 poll in Iowa puts Senator Barack Obama significantly ahead of Senator John McCain.

Obama 53%

McCain39%

PPP Poll: North Carolina Deadlocked

The latest Public Policy Polling poll in North Carolina finds the presidential election tied there with Barack Obama and John McCain each getting 46% of voters’ support.

Latest Marist Polls: MI, OH, PA

The latest Marist College polls show Obama up 9 points in Michigan, up 2 points in Ohio and up 4 points in Pennsylvania from the previous poll.

Ohio: Obama 44%, McCain 44%

Michigan: Obama 50%, McCain 41%

Pennsylvania: Obama 45%, McCain 42%

Latest Polls Show Obama Leads in Colorado While McCain Ahead in Virginia

In the battleground state of Colorado, Obama is now up 10 points, while the latest Virginia Insider Advantage poll has McCain up by 2 points.

Colorado: Obama 51%, McCain 41%

Virginia: McCain 48%, Obama 46%
